A ferry service connecting Taiwan with Japan's Ishigaki Island is set to make its maiden voyage, according to Nikkei Asia. The route would provide a direct maritime link between Taiwan and Ishigaki, which is part of Japan's Okinawa Prefecture. The specific departure port in Taiwan and the ferry operator have not been detailed in the source, but the service is expected to commence shortly. Ishigaki Island is a popular tourist destination known for its beaches and natural scenery. The new ferry route might offer a more leisurely and potentially lower-cost alternative to the existing air service. The voyage could also facilitate small-scale cargo movement, supporting local businesses on both sides. The exact travel time and frequency of the service remain unconfirmed, but such a route would likely operate on a regular schedule to attract passengers. The launch of this ferry service comes amid ongoing cross-strait dynamics, though the route is purely international between Taiwan and Japan. It may also serve as a symbolic boost to people-to-people exchanges in the region. Key takeaways from this development include the potential for increased tourism flows between Taiwan and Japan's southern islands. Taiwan is a major source of visitors to Japan, and a direct ferry to Ishigaki could open a new gateway for travelers exploring the Ryukyu Islands. The service might also appeal to Taiwanese tourists who prefer sea travel over flights. From an economic perspective, the route could support trade in regional specialties such as agricultural products or seafood. However, the success of the service would likely depend on competitive pricing, reliable scheduling, and weather conditions—especially during typhoon season. The ferry may also face competition from established airlines offering short flights. The geopolitical context is notable: this ferry adds a new transport link between Taiwan and Japan, both of which have territorial interests in the East China Sea. While the route itself is civilian and commercial, it could be seen as strengthening ties between the two democracies. Investment implications of this ferry service are largely indirect. Tourism-related businesses in Ishigaki—such as hotels, restaurants, and tour operators—might see increased demand if the ferry attracts a steady flow of Taiwanese visitors. Similarly, travel agencies and transportation companies in Taiwan could benefit from offering packages that include the ferry. However, investors should exercise caution, as the service's profitability is not yet established. Factors such as fuel costs, port fees, and passenger numbers would influence financial outcomes. The route may also require subsidies or promotional efforts to achieve sustainable operation. Broader implications for regional connectivity are possible: if successful, the model could be replicated for other island-hopping routes in East Asia. The ferry service might also encourage further investment in port infrastructure on Ishigaki. As with any new transport link, market adaptation and consumer acceptance would be key determinants of long-term viability.
